Another gallery in a phone box

Perhaps not surprisingly, since it's such a great idea, it turns out we're not the only people who thought of using a phone box as an art gallery. Local artist Teresa Crawford-Docherty converted a phone box in Halesowen into an art gallery where it has attracted lots of local attention. Her website has more information.

The Gallery is launched!


Our opening ceremony yesterday was attended by around 70 people - more than we've ever seen at once on The Green! The picture was taken by Mark Rand and shows the Mayor of Settle, Councillor Barbara McLernon, cutting the ribbon.

A world record? Or not?

We put in a claim to the Guinness Book of Records to see if we really are the smallest art gallery in the world. We've just heard back from them that they are unable to investigate our claim as they have limited resources which can only be used for the most 'interesting' and 'important' of claims. So we'll carry on with our claim and see if anyone tells us about a smaller art gallery!
